Charissa West is a high school classroom teacher turned stay-at-home, work-at-home mom. When she’s not chasing around her three young sons, she works as an online teacher and freelance writer. She shares her honest, sarcastic, hilarious thoughts on parenting on her blog, The Wild, Wild West, with the goal of helping moms laugh at anything motherhood may throw at them.
